Bridal FAQ's

When should I schedule an appointment? 
Each gown is uniquely crafted for the bride to ensure precise fitting and detailing. Each gown takes quite the time to handcraft and requires multiple fittings for precise fit. We aim for you to begin your process of Bridal development no later than 8 months before the wedding date to allot for consultations and possible delays.
 
What should you bring?
The bride is suggested to bring any heirlooms they want to incorporate in their wedding dress.  We also recommend bringing proper undergarments and an ideal shoe height for reference of what will be worn on the day of the wedding.
 
The beginning costs? 
CELESTINO prides itself in using luxury fabrics and couture hand techniques to create their gowns; the cost of a wedding dress depends on the complexity/customization of the design. It will also cover consultations, and multiple fittings.

How many people can I bring to my fitting?
The bride is welcome to bring up to 5 family members or friends to the consultations and fittings.
Can I take photos of the development Process?
Process photos are encouraged to be shot so you can document your special experience.
